Output 8158fe310b46f17c5122df4b0b3eb6a0a62d67cf31b220b8c2bd42e608e74a26:8

value
290000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f714beb3c36234af64383b6fc5c87db37741a55a OP_EQUAL
address
3QDTgJsQqx7CySa5hsZVbbu8oSkG3UUtfw
transaction
8158fe310b46f17c5122df4b0b3eb6a0a62d67cf31b220b8c2bd42e608e74a26
spent
true